|◀ 517 - 528 of 530 ▶|
View:
Your Price:
670.00
Each
Contact us to order
Contact us to order
Contact us to order
Contact us to order
Contact us to order
Your Price:
330.00
Each
Out of Stock
Your Price:
1305.00
Each
Out of Stock
Item#:
9781119900085
Your Price:
1540.00
Each
Out of Stock
Your Price:
1469.00
Each
Out of Stock
Item#:
9781119900086
Your Price:
1853.00
Each
Item#:
9781119900083
Your Price:
1289.00
Each
|◀ 517 - 528 of 530 ▶|
View: